Address 116.1628 DOGE

DKki1iABguHe5K9uuRAcXuc5y1fhG7PcuY

Confirmed

Total Received116.1628 DOGE
Total Sent0 DOGE
Final Balance116.1628 DOGE
No. Transactions1

Transactions